The crosman 1077 hits fairly hard with a full co2. Mine can get to 620 fps on a full 12gram.

Theyre are all sorts of mods I am learning. For starters a bulk system is a good way to upgrade the gun. I have seen such modifications on this gun such as barrel shrouds, Longer barrels, bulk systems, a verry rare valve mod, and even a .22 caliber mod!

I like the can! And Nice bulk setup on your gun!

Mine has a "fake can" 3-9x31 scope, C,amp on SKS bipod, and a shotgun shell stock that holds 12 grams! It almost looks just like a real smiper riffle. The fake can actually helps to.

Anyone ever heard of silincing the internals? I silenced mine by putting a piece of rubber on the end of the hammer.

I kind of fixed the trigger problemn by changin all the springs to lighter ones. It's not so bad once you get the use to it.
